Arrosticini arrive in the heart of Testaccio

The Arrosticini and Abruzzo Cuisine Festival is one of the most popular gastronomic events of the Roman spring. It takes place at the Città dell'Altra Economia, a repurposed space within the Ex Mattatoio of Testaccio, in the city of Rome, capital of the Lazio region. This venue, with its historical ties to the meat trade and butchery, fills for four days with the unmistakable, mouth-watering aroma of charcoal-grilled meat.

The event was born from a desire to bring the authentic cuisine of Abruzzo to Rome—a neighboring region deeply connected to the capital by a continuous flow of people, traditions, and flavors. The undisputed star is the arrosticino: a small skewer of cubed mutton, cooked on the traditional canala, the narrow, elongated grill typical of Abruzzo's pastoral heritage.

What to eat

Alongside classic arrosticini, the stalls offer a wide range of traditional Abruzzo specialties and street food:

  • Mutton arrosticini freshly grilled and served in bundles
  • Liver arrosticini and other variations for the more adventurous palate
  • Pallotte cacio e ova, the iconic cheese and egg dumplings of peasant cuisine
  • Ventricina, cured meats, mountain cheeses, and wood-fired bread
  • Fried snacks, grilled vegetables, and fried apples for a sweet finish
  • Craft beers and wines from Central Italy, from Montepulciano d'Abruzzo to Trebbiano

The dining area features a dozen bar points and themed corners, with an open-air beer garden spanning over 4,000 square meters, equipped with communal tables where you can eat standing or side-by-side, creating a village-fair atmosphere transplanted into the city.

Why it's worth visiting

Testaccio has always been the Roman neighborhood of popular cuisine, offal dishes, and historic trattorias. Hosting a festival dedicated to Abruzzo's charcoal grilling here creates a dialogue between two complementary gastronomic traditions. The result is an event that is very Roman in spirit—convivial, loud, and informal—but with roots firmly planted between the Gran Sasso and the Majella mountains.

Admission is free until capacity is reached: you only pay for what you consume. On weekend evenings, the turnout is high, so it is best to arrive early or visit during off-peak hours.

Practical information — Arrosticini Festival

Location

Città dell'Altra Economia, Largo Dino Frisullo, Ex Mattatoio di Testaccio, 00153 Rome.

How to get there

  • Metro: Line B, Piramide stop, then about a 10-minute walk.
  • Train: Roma Ostiense station, a few minutes' walk away.
  • Tram: Line 3, Marmorata or Piramide stop.
  • Car: High-traffic area with limited parking; public transport is highly recommended.
